Mark Hahn wrote:
if your ram disk or local storage is 128MB, over a 2Mbps connect, i make
it 8 mins, nearer 9 to load which is... urm slow.
again this for a 100Mbps hub you would get 10.24 seconds per node.
Ah thanks for noticing this, hadn't realized this timing problem yet!
well, 128M of traffic to boot is pretty extreme. I haven't tcpdumped it,
but it looks like around 2-4MB is all that's needed using the NFS-root approach.
